Game Description
Chicktionary is a word game available on the Microsoft Internet search page. Chicktionary was developed by Blockdot, a Dallas, Texas based developer of games and branded entertainment applications. The game was originally developed as “Fowl Words” but later changed after it was concluded that the play on words “fowl” would be confused with “foul” and alienate potential players.
